取消绑定:
在jQuery中,取消绑定是指解除元素与事件处理函数之间的关联。通过取消绑定,可以停止特定事件的监听和响应。取消绑定可以通过off()
方法来实现,该方法接受一个或多个事件类型和可选的选择器参数,用于指定要取消绑定的事件和元素。
示例代码:
// 取消绑定所有点击事件
$('button').off('click');
// 取消绑定特定事件类型和选择器的事件
$('button').off('click', '.myClass');
删除:
在jQuery中,删除是指从DOM中移除指定的元素。通过删除元素,可以彻底从页面中移除该元素及其子元素,并释放相关的内存资源。删除元素可以使用remove()
方法来实现,该方法会将元素及其相关的数据和事件处理函数从DOM中移除。
示例代码:
// 删除指定元素
$('#myElement').remove();
// 删除特定选择器的元素
$('.myClass').remove();
杀死jQuery插件:
在jQuery中,插件是通过扩展jQuery库来实现特定功能的代码块。杀死jQuery插件通常是指停止插件的运行并释放相关的资源。由于插件的实现方式各不相同,因此杀死插件的具体方法也会有所不同。一般来说,可以通过取消绑定事件、移除相关元素以及释放占用的内存资源来实现插件的停止运行。
示例代码:
// 取消绑定插件事件
$('#myElement').off('pluginEvent');
// 移除插件相关元素
$('#pluginContainer').remove();
// 释放插件占用的资源
$.pluginName = null;
请注意,以上示例代码中的myElement
、myClass
、pluginEvent
、pluginContainer
、pluginName
等为占位符,需要根据具体情况进行替换。
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,以上推荐的腾讯云产品仅供参考,具体选择需根据实际需求进行评估。
领取专属 10元无门槛券
手把手带您无忧上云